In 1831, founded by the scholar Karl Karmarsch, the “Higher Trade School of Hannover” started with only 64 students. Today there are more than 25,000 students in the natural sciences and engineering, the humanities and social sciences as well as in law and economics.

Internationalisation is very important at Leibniz Universität Hannover: there are cooperation agreements all over the world for research and teaching as well as for student exchanges. More than 4,000 of the approx. 25,000 students come from abroad. Visiting scholars from abroad enrich research and teaching, and the introduction of Bachelor"s and Master"s degree courses contribute toward the internationalisation of the courses on offer.

The heart of Leibniz Universität Hannover beats in the idyllic Welfenschloss, the Guelph Palace. The year 1879 saw the Higher Vocational School, originally founded in 1831, move into the palace. Later, the Higher Vocational School became the Königliche Technische Hochschule, the Royal College of Technology. While 64 pupils first attended the Vocational School, the university now has around 28.000 students. More than 3.000 academics and scientists work at the university in 9 faculties with around 160 departments and institutes.
About 90 courses offer forward-looking training for young academics. More than 300 professors and over 2,600 non-professorial academics in 208 institutes investigate questions in science and engineering, humanities and social sciences, and interdisciplinary issues, thus laying the foundations for tackling today"s social challenges. By pooling outstanding individual achievements across the disciplines we are able to draw international attention to our excellent research.
Leibniz Universität Hannover is among the world"s leading institutions in its key research areas "Quantum Optics and Gravitational Physics", "Production Engineering", "Biomedical Research and Engineering", and "Interdisciplinary Studies of Science and Academia". Our innovative strength in developing precision measurement methods, optical technologies, novel materials, intelligent implants and innovations in Information Technology or in the field of Industry 4.0 stems from these.

The objective of changing the name "University of Hannover" to "Gottfried Wilhelm Leibniz Universität Hannover" (Leibniz Universität Hannover for short) is to give all of the university"s faculties a home under the umbrella of the universal scholar, promoting interaction within and between them.
In 2007, the university introduced its new Mission Statement in which the university"s profile, with special reference to Leibniz, is enshrined. A new logo and a comprehensive corporate design were also created.

For 40 creative years of his life Gottfried Wilhelm Leibniz was associated with Hannover. He made major contributions to all areas of contemporary knowledge. His universality and inspiration have created an example and set a commitment for Leibniz Universität Hannover.
